2. Anchor AN1

Anchors serve as the backbone of a tracking network. They receive signals from tags and calculate their positions with remarkable accuracy, providing a real-time overview of your facility. Scalable and easy to install, anchors adapt seamlessly to both small and large operations, making them an essential component of any UWB indoor positioning system.

Ultra-Wideband (UWB) Technology: Key Advantages and Disadvantages Explained

Ultra-Wideband (UWB) is a wireless communication technology that operates over a wide frequency spectrum (typically greater than 500 MHz). Unlike conventional narrowband systems, UWB transmits information by sending short-duration pulses over a wide frequency range, which allows for high data rates and precise positioning capabilities. UWB has gained significant attention in recent years due to its applications in areas such as indoor positioning systems , secure keyless entry, health monitoring, and wireless communication. However, like any technology, UWB comes with both advantages and disadvantages. Advantages of UWB High Precision Location Tracking One of the standout features of UWB is its ability to provide highly accurate location tracking, often within a few centimeters. This makes it ideal for indoor navigation, asset tracking, and smart home applications where precise positioning is crucial.
